新書推薦:
《
爱琴海的光芒 : 千年古希腊文明
》
售價:HK$
199.4
《
不被他人左右:基于阿德勒心理学的无压力工作法
》
售價:HK$
66.1
《
SDGSAT-1卫星热红外影像图集
》
售價:HK$
445.8
《
股市趋势技术分析(原书第11版)
》
售價:HK$
221.8
《
汉匈战争全史
》
售價:HK$
99.7
《
恶的哲学研究(社会思想丛书)
》
售價:HK$
109.8
《
不止江湖
》
售價:HK$
98.6
《
天才留步!——从文艺复兴到新艺术运动(一本关于艺术天才的鲜活故事集,聚焦艺术史的高光时刻!)
》
售價:HK$
154.6
|
編輯推薦: |
系统性:本书从三个主要方面——上机实验指导、习题解答和解析以及计算机等级考试大纲和真题解析——进行了详细组织和讲解,为读者提供了一个系统性的学习路径。这种结构确保了读者能够全面地理解和掌握C语言程序设计的知识,不仅停留在理论层面,更能够通过实践加深理解和应用。
实践性:C语言程序设计作为一门实践性极强的课程,要求读者通过大量的上机实践来真正巩固和体会运用计算机语言解决具体问题的过程。本书的上机实验指导部分,特别是验证实验、陷阱实验和提高实验三个环节,为读者提供了丰富的实践机会,有助于提高其动手编程能力。
针对性:本书主要作为计算机及相关学科学生的课程教材,同时也为相关领域的研究人员和工程技术人员提供参考。这种针对性确保了本书的内容既符合学术要求,又能满足实际应用的需要,具有很高的实用价值。
深入解析:习题参考答案和解析部分不仅提供了各章的学习目标、基本知识点、重点和难点,还列出了每章的知识体系结构,最后是各章全部习题的参考答案和解析。这种深入的解析方式有助于读者深化对C语言程序设计的理解,提高解决问题的能力。
考试指导:全国计算机等级考试“二级 C 语言程序设计”考试的
|
內容簡介: |
全书从三方面进行了精心组织和详细讲解,旨在为读者上机实践和全国计算机等级考试方面提供帮助。第一部分是上机实验指导,包括实验目的和实验内容,其中实验内容进一步分为验证实验、陷阱实验和进阶实验三个环节; 第二部分是习题参考答案和解析,包括提供学习目标、基本知识点、重点和难点,然后列出了每章的知识体系结构,最后是各章全部习题的参考答案和解析; 第三部分是全国计算机等级考试“二级C语言程序设计”考试大纲,最后一部分提供了全国计算机等级考试“二级C语言程序设计”的真题及详解。
本书主要作为计算机及相关学科专业的课程配套教材,也可供相关领域的研究人员和工程技术人员参考。
|
目錄:
|
第1章 上机实验 1
1.1 熟悉 C 语言编程环境 2
1.1.1 实验目的 2
1.1.2 实验内容 2
1.2 用 C 语言编写简单程序 10
1.2.1 实验目的 10
1.2.2 实验内容 10
1.3 顺序结构程序设计 14
1.3.1 实验目的 14
1.3.2 实验内容 14
1.4 选择结构程序设计 17
1.4.1 实验目的 17
1.4.2 实验内容 18
1.5 循环结构程序设计 22
1.5.1 循环结构 22
1.5.2 嵌套循环 24
1.6 数组 26
1.6.1 一维数组 26
1.6.2 二维数组 29
1.6.3 字符数组 34
1.7 函数 36
1.7.1 实验目的 36
1.7.2 实验内容 36
1.8 指针 42
1.8.1 指针与数组 42
1.8.2 指针与字符串 46
1.8.3 指针数组、指针与函数 49
1.9 构造数据类型 55
1.9.1 实验目的 55
1.9.2 实验内容 56
1.10 文件 63
1.10.1 实验目的 63
1.10.2 实验内容 63
第2章 习题参考答案和解析 69
2.1 习题1参考答案和解析 70
2.1.1 本章知识体系结构 70
2.1.2 教材中习题及参考答案 70
2.2 习题2参考答案和解析 72
2.2.1 本章知识体系结构 72
2.2.2 教材中习题及参考答案 73
2.3 习题3参考答案和解析 76
2.3.1 本章知识体系结构 76
2.3.2 教材中习题及参考答案 76
2.4 习题4参考答案和解析 81
2.4.1 本章知识体系结构 81
2.4.2 教材中习题及参考答案 82
2.5 习题5参考答案和解析 87
2.5.1 本章知识体系结构 87
2.5.2 教材中习题及参考答案 87
2.6 习题6参考答案和解析 99
2.6.1 本章知识体系结构 99
2.6.2 教材中习题及参考答案 100
2.7 习题7参考答案和解析 113
2.7.1 本章知识体系结构 113
2.7.2 教材中习题及参考答案 114
2.8 习题8参考答案和解析 124
2.8.1 本章知识体系结构 124
2.8.2 教材中习题及参考答案 126
2.9 习题9参考答案和解析 139
2.9.1 本章知识体系结构 139
2.9.2 教材中习题及参考答案 139
2.10 习题10参考答案和解析 153
2.10.1 本章知识体系结构 153
2.10.2 教材中习题及参考答案 154
2.11 习题11参考答案和解析 158
2.11.1 本章知识体系结构 158
2.11.2 教材中习题及参考答案 159
2.12 习题12参考答案和解析 164
2.12.1 本章知识体系结构 164
2.12.2 教材中习题及参考答案 165 第3章 全国计算机等级考试“二级C语言程序设计”考试大纲
(2023年版) 167
3.1 基本要求 168
3.2 考试内容 168
3.3 考试方式 170
第4章 全国计算机等级考试“二级C语言程序设计”试题 171
|
內容試閱:
|
“C语言程序设计”是一门实践性强的课程,读者需要通过大量的上机实践来巩固和思考运用计算机语言解决具体问题的过程,熟练使用编译器(如DevC 6.3)开发环境,从而提高编程能力。
为此,我们编写了这本与《C语言程序设计面向“新工科”人才培养(微课视频版)》配套的辅导教材。本书从以下三方面进行了精心的组织和详细的讲解,旨在为读者上机实践提供帮助。
1. 上机实验指导
上机实验指导包括实验目的和实验内容,其中实验内容分为验证实验、陷阱实验和进阶实验三个环节。①验证实验需遵循实验操作步骤,直到获得程序运行结果。完成验证实验后,读者需要进一步思考,对实验进行改进; ②陷阱实验则涉及修正错误的程序并获得正确的运行结果; ③进阶实验要求学生能够根据问题描述独立编写源程序并得到要求的运行结果。这三个环节循序渐进,引导学生从模仿输入和阅读修改逐渐过渡到独立完成程序,同时鼓励他们创新和完善,以解决更复杂的问题。所有的代码都已在DevC 6.3开发环境中验证。
2. 习题参考答案和解析
本部分包括学习目标、基本知识点、重点和难点,同时列出了每章的知识体系结构,以及各章所有习题的参考答案和解析。在这里,编程题的源程序都严格遵循编码规范,并与教材案例的编码风格保持一致。对于较复杂的问题,书中还提供了详细的分析过程和解决问题的基本思路。所有的代码都已在DevC 6.3开发环境中验证。
3. 全国计算机等级考试“二级C语言程序设计”考试大纲和试题
“二级C语言程序设计”是全国计算机等级考试(National Computer Rank Examination,NCRE)的一项考核内容,因此,本书在最后列出了全国计算机等级考试“二级C语言程序设计”的考试大纲,并提供了两套全国计算机等级考试“二级C语言程序设计”的真题及详解,以帮助参加全国计算机等级考试的读者。
本书由徐新爱进行顶层设计和执笔,参与修订工作的教师有卢昕(第1~4章)、秦春影(第5~8章)、朱莹婷(第9~12章)。在本书的编写过程中,还得到了南昌师范学院计算机教研室全体教师的大力支持,特别感谢程序设计类课程群教学团队、江西省高水平本科教学团队。
由于编者水平有限,书中难免存在不足和疏漏之处,希望广大读者提出宝贵意见和建议。
编者
2023年10月
|
|